Floor renovation services involve updating and restoring existing flooring to improve appearance, functionality, and durability. This process can include replacing worn-out or damaged materials, refinishing surfaces to remove scratches and stains, or installing new finishes that enhance the look of a space. Whether it's a hardwood floor showing signs of wear, a tile surface with cracks, or a carpet that has become stained and outdated, professional contractors can assess the condition of the flooring and recommend the most suitable solutions. These services help transform tired, damaged floors into fresh, attractive surfaces that can significantly enhance the overall feel of a home or commercial property.
Many common problems lead property owners to seek floor renovation services. Over time, floors can develop scratches, dents, or discoloration from daily use. Moisture damage, warping, or loose tiles can also compromise the safety and stability of a flooring surface. Additionally, outdated flooring styles may no longer match a property's interior design, prompting a desire for a modern update. Renovating floors can address these issues, restoring structural integrity, improving safety, and giving spaces a more contemporary appearance. The overview below groups typical Floor Renovation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Asheville,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or floor repairs or refinishing jobs in Asheville range from $250-$600.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, depending on the size and condition of the floor.
Surface Refinishing - refinishing or resealing existing floors us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. Larger or more detailed refinishing projects can reach up to $4,500, but most fall within this typical band.
Partial Floor Replacement - replacing sections of flooring or installing new surface layers generally costs $2,500-$7,000. Many projects in Asheville stay in the middle of this range, with fewer reaching the higher end for extensive work.
Full Floor Replacement - complete removal and installation of new flooring can range from $5,000-$15,000 or more. Larger, complex projects tend to push into the higher tiers, while most residential jobs are in the lower to mid-range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of flooring materials can local contractors install during a renovation? Local service providers in Asheville can install a variety of flooring options such as hardwood, laminate, tile, vinyl, and carpet, depending on the project requirements.
How do local contractors prepare a space for a floor renovation? They typically remove existing flooring, assess the subfloor condition, and ensure the surface is level and clean to provide a proper foundation for the new flooring.
Can local pros help with repairing damaged floors before installing new material? Yes, many local contractors offer repair services to address issues like cracks, squeaks, or water damage prior to flooring installation.
What should be considered when choosing a flooring style with a local service provider? Factors such as durability, aesthetic preferences, and the specific use of the space are discussed with local pros to select the best flooring style.
Do local contractors handle the removal and disposal of old flooring? Many service providers include removal and proper disposal of old flooring as part of their renovation services.
